随着网络环境的日益复杂和对网络隐私安全需求的增加,越来越多的用户开始使用v2ray作为科学上网工具。v2ray的强大之处不仅在于其灵活的配置和强大的混淆能力,也体现在其支持多种不同的传输协议。然而,对于很多用户来说,在众多的v2ray协议中选择一种最优的协议并不容易。本文将对v2ray常见的协议进行详细比较,帮助用户找到最适合自己需求的协议。
协议一:VMess
- 优点:
- 支持tcp、kcp、ws和http等多种传输方式。
- 配置灵活,可以根据需求进行定制。
- 缺点:
- 需要客户端和服务器端都支持。
- 对服务器端要求较高,配置相对复杂。
协议二:Shadowsocks
- 优点:
- 简单易用,配置相对简单。
- 老牌翻墙协议,稳定性较高。
- 缺点:
- 传输效率相对较低。
- 对抗深度数据包检测能力较弱。
协议三:Trojan
- 优点:
- 伪装能力强,隐蔽性高。
- 突破部分网络封锁效果较好。
- 缺点:
- 对设备性能有一定要求。
- 不如VMess和Shadowsocks稳定。
协议四:VLESS
- 优点:
- 与VMess类似,但在性能和安全性上做了优化。
- 更安全的传输方式。
- 缺点:
- 相对较新,兼容性可能有待提升。
- 配置相对复杂。
根据上述比较,用户可以根据自己的需求和实际使用环境来选择合适的v2ray协议。对于普通用户来说,Shadowsocks可能是一个不错的选择,而对于更注重安全性和灵活性的用户,则可以考虑VMess或VLESS。
FAQ
什么是v2ray协议?
V2ray是一个帮助你穿透防火墙的工具,它使用了自己开发的传输协议vmess。通过v2ray协议,用户可以实现更稳定和更高效的网络访问。
VMess和VLESS有什么区别?
VMess是v2ray的一种传输协议,而VLESS是在VMess基础上进行了性能和安全性优化的新协议。VLESS相对于VMess更安全、更高效。
Trojan与Shadowsocks有何不同?
Trojan协议相比Shadowsocks在伪装和突破网络封锁方面有所优势,但相对于Shadowsocks,Trojan要求设备性能更高。
选用v2ray协议时如何权衡各个协议之间的优缺点?
用户可以根据自己的网络环境、性能要求、对隐私保护的重视程度等因素来选择适合自己的协议。比如,对于普通用户来说,Shadowsocks可以满足基本需求;而对于需要更高安全性和灵活性的用户,则可以选择VMess或VLESS。
以上是关于v2ray不同协议比较的内容,希望对选择合适的协议有所帮助。
正文完